diff --git a/telemetry/generated/web.ts b/telemetry/generated/web.ts index e74ffb308c..55d2d6af18 100644 --- a/telemetry/generated/web.ts +++ b/telemetry/generated/web.ts @@ -4,8 +4,8 @@ // AUTOGENERATED BY glean_parser v8.1.1. DO NOT EDIT. DO NOT COMMIT. +import UrlMetricType from "@mozilla/glean/private/metrics/url"; import EventMetricType from "@mozilla/glean/private/metrics/event"; -import StringMetricType from "@mozilla/glean/private/metrics/string"; /** * Event triggered when a user clicks a link on a web page. @@ -39,7 +39,7 @@ export const linkClick = new EventMetricType<{ * * Generated from `web.page_url`. */ -export const pageUrl = new StringMetricType({ +export const pageUrl = new UrlMetricType({ category: "web", name: "page_url", sendInPings: ["events"], @@ -77,7 +77,7 @@ export const pageView = new EventMetricType({ * * Generated from `web.referrer_url`. */ -export const referrerUrl = new StringMetricType({ +export const referrerUrl = new UrlMetricType({ category: "web", name: "referrer_url", sendInPings: ["events"], diff --git a/telemetry/metrics.yaml b/telemetry/metrics.yaml index 2f1031305b..37be6bb2e8 100644 --- a/telemetry/metrics.yaml +++ b/telemetry/metrics.yaml @@ -241,7 +241,7 @@ ui: web: page_url: - type: string + type: url description: > The full URL of the page that was visited, along with URL query parameters. @@ -264,7 +264,7 @@ web: - events referrer_url: - type: string + type: url description: > The full URL of the previous web page from which a link was followed in order to trigger the page view.